Collect, win and strengthen the city center from 12 September to 12 October
The district town will also participate in the nationwide "Shop Local" campaign organized by the Chambers of Industry and Commerce in 2025. The goal of the campaign is to strengthen local retail and restaurants, emphasize the importance of local shopping, and safeguard the attractiveness of city centers. Around 30 municipalities in southern Hesse are participating.
"The campaign is a very good initiative to highlight the central importance of local retail and restaurants. Combined with our city voucher 'GG-Scheck' as a chance to win prizes, the campaign also strengthens Groß-Gerau as a shopping destination," emphasize the organizers from the city's economic development agency and trade association.
Collection campaign with vouchers
From September 12th to October 12th, customers will receive stickers when shopping or eating at participating stores, which they can enter on a collection card. Anyone who collects five stickers can exchange the card for a city voucher worth five euros at the reception desk in the town hall. A total of 200 vouchers are available – while supplies last. Main raffle and additional promotions
In addition, all submitted trading cards will be entered into a main drawing for city vouchers totaling €500. The drawing is scheduled to begin in calendar week 42.
The eye-catching shopping bags are also part of the campaign again. In 2025, they will bear the slogan "Quite simply: buy local" – a clear signal of support for local businesses.
Support from the mayor
Mayor Jörg Rüddenklau emphasizes: "A vibrant city center is an important factor for the quality of life in Groß-Gerau and the surrounding area. 'Shop Locally' highlights the value of shopping in your own town and supporting local restaurants."
